Summary
The speaker, who has extensively used various note-taking and PKM tools over years (Rome Research, Obsidian, Notion, Mem, Tana, Heptabase), argues that the era of traditional PKM tools is ending. He claims these tools lock users into developer-defined structures and scaffolds, requiring dependency on plugins and external developers for customization. The fundamental shift involves replacing PKM (Personal Knowledge Management) with PKA (Personal Knowledge Assistance) using Claude AI.
The core setup is remarkably simple: a basic folder on a computer plus Claude. The speaker creates a folder structure with three main directories (owner's inbox, team inbox, team folder) and uses Claude Code in the terminal to set up an AI team. Through natural language conversation, he establishes Larry as an orchestrator AI agent, who then hires team members like Pax (researcher) and Nolan (HR director). Each agent has a persona, identity, and specialized role.
Critically, the speaker emphasizes that the data remains completely local and portable—not locked into any proprietary format. The system creates a SQLite database that stores all information, which can then be visualized through simple HTML interfaces built by hired AI agents. When the speaker demonstrates uploading 120+ scanned PDF files, Larry automatically organizes them, performs OCR, and indexes them in the database without any manual coding required.
The speaker shows the process of asking the AI team to hire a front-end developer (Sable) to build a custom interface for viewing the database. Initially, Sable overcomplicates it by creating a full application, but the speaker corrects course by asking for a simple HTML visualization instead. The resulting interface displays journal entries, contacts, files, and projects in a clean dashboard.
Key differentiators from traditional tools include: full local control of data, ability to swap AI providers without losing work, no plugin dependency, natural language interaction instead of learning tool-specific workflows, and the ability to build completely custom interfaces and workflows. The speaker argues this approach provides genuine ownership and flexibility that tools like Obsidian falsely promise, since Obsidian files remain bound to Obsidian's formatting and interpretation.
